I downloaded the avast rpm to my desktop on 10.3 suse, tried to install with yast-it goes through the install process and then nothing.I can't find the program anywhere?

If you can remember the exact name of the package try
rpm -qp rpm-package name

this will list the files in the rpm.
You do not need anti virus software on linux. However if your Suse box is on a network with windows
computers, then this will prevent you passing on viruses to windows clients, but on linux a windows
virus has no effect.
